Does dirty air cool the climate?

Study adds a factor to climate-change debate.

By Peter N. Spotts | Staff writer of The Christian Science Monitor


Over the past several decades, industrial countries have made major strides in cleaning up pollutants roiling from smokestacks.
But some researchers now say this progress could have a troubling side effect - accelerating the pace of global warming.


The reason: Tiny pollutant particles, once airborne, can reflect sunlight back into space, easing temperatures in what is known as aerosol cooling. By cleaning up industrial pollution, countries are reducing the effect of this cooling.

Nobody is recommending that nations halt efforts to curb pollution."
